1126 7th Avenue Northwest
Rio Rancho, New Mexico, 87124
Commute to Downtown Rio Rancho
1126 7th Avenue Northwest has a Walk Score of 0 out of 100. This location is a Car-Dependent neighborhood so almost all errands require a car.
This location is in Rio Rancho.
Explore how far you can travel by car, bus, bike and foot from 1126 7th Avenue Northwest.
View all Rio Rancho apartments on a map.
Popular apartment searches include fireplace, pool and single family.
This location is in the city of Rio Rancho, NM. Rio Rancho has an average Walk Score of 13 and has 87,521 residents.
Learn More About Rio Rancho